| /**
 | |
|   @defgroup MatrixSub Matrix Subtraction
 | |
| 
 | |
|   Subtract two matrices.
 | |
|   \image html MatrixSubtraction.gif "Subraction of two 3 x 3 matrices"
 | |
| 
 | |
|   The functions check to make sure that
 | |
|   <code>pSrcA</code>, <code>pSrcB</code>, and <code>pDst</code> have the same
 | |
|   number of rows and columns.
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| /**
 | |
|   @addtogroup MatrixSub
 | |
|   @{
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| /**
 | |
|   @brief         Floating-point matrix subtraction.
 | |
|   @param[in]     pSrcA      points to the first input matrix structure
 | |
|   @param[in]     pSrcB      points to the second input matrix structure
 | |
|   @param[out]    pDst       points to output matrix structure
 | |
|   @return        execution status
 | |
|                    - \ref ARM_MATH_SUCCESS       : Operation successful
 | |
|                    - \ref ARM_MATH_SIZE_MISMATCH : Matrix size check failed
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| arm_status arm_mat_sub_f64(
 | |
|   const arm_matrix_instance_f64 * pSrcA,
 | |
|   const arm_matrix_instance_f64 * pSrcB,
 | |
|         arm_matrix_instance_f64 * pDst)
 | |
| {
 | |
|   float64_t *pInA = pSrcA->pData;                /* input data matrix pointer A */
 | |
|   float64_t *pInB = pSrcB->pData;                /* input data matrix pointer B */
 | |
|   float64_t *pOut = pDst->pData;                 /* output data matrix pointer */
 | |
| 
 | |
|   uint64_t numSamples;                           /* total number of elements in the matrix */
 | |
|   uint64_t blkCnt;                               /* loop counters */
 | |
|   arm_status status;                             /* status of matrix subtraction */
 | |
| 
 | |
| #ifdef ARM_MATH_MATRIX_CHECK
 | |
| 
 | |
|   /* Check for matrix mismatch condition */
 | |
|   if ((pSrcA->numRows != pSrcB->numRows) ||
 | |
|       (pSrcA->numCols != pSrcB->numCols) ||
 | |
|       (pSrcA->numRows != pDst->numRows)  ||
 | |
|       (pSrcA->numCols != pDst->numCols)    )
 | |
|   {
 | |
|     /* Set status as ARM_MATH_SIZE_MISMATCH */
 | |
|     status = ARM_MATH_SIZE_MISMATCH;
 | |
|   }
 | |
|   else
 | |
| 
 | |
| #endif /* #ifdef ARM_MATH_MATRIX_CHECK */
 | |
| 
 | |
|   {
 | |
|     /* Total number of samples in input matrix */
 | |
|     numSamples = (uint64_t) pSrcA->numRows * pSrcA->numCols;
 | |
| 
 | |
| #if defined (ARM_MATH_LOOPUNROLL)
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Loop unrolling: Compute 4 outputs at a time */
 | |
|     blkCnt = numSamples >> 2U;
 | |
| 
 | |
|     while (blkCnt > 0U)
 | |
|     {
 | |
|       /* C(m,n) = A(m,n) - B(m,n) */
 | |
| 
 | |
|       /* Subtract and store result in destination buffer. */
 | |
|       *pOut++ = (*pInA++) - (*pInB++);
 | |
|       *pOut++ = (*pInA++) - (*pInB++);
 | |
|       *pOut++ = (*pInA++) - (*pInB++);
 | |
|       *pOut++ = (*pInA++) - (*pInB++);
 | |
| 
 | |
|       /* Decrement loop counter */
 | |
|       blkCnt--;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Loop unrolling: Compute remaining outputs */
 | |
|     blkCnt = numSamples % 0x4U;
 | |
| 
 | |
| #else
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Initialize blkCnt with number of samples */
 | |
|     blkCnt = numSamples;
 | |
| 
 | |
| #endif /* #if defined (ARM_MATH_LOOPUNROLL) */
 | |
| 
 | |
|     while (blkCnt > 0U)
 | |
|     {
 | |
|       /* C(m,n) = A(m,n) - B(m,n) */
 | |
| 
 | |
|       /* Subtract and store result in destination buffer. */
 | |
|       *pOut++ = (*pInA++) - (*pInB++);
 | |
| 
 | |
|       /* Decrement loop counter */
 | |
|       blkCnt--;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     /* Set status as ARM_MATH_SUCCESS */
 | |
|     status = ARM_MATH_SUCCESS;
 | |
|   }
 | |
| 
 | |
|   /* Return to application */
 | |
|   return (status);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| /**
 | |
|   @} end of MatrixSub group
 | |
|  */
